Transaction 891a8d6c93e8d679a7fecea2ce606541eb5949618af551edc45ecb257c3a9d14
1 Input
1 Output
-
891a8d6c93e8d679a7fecea2ce606541eb5949618af551edc45ecb257c3a9d14:0
- value
- 23719322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1adaf6ae608f0a237b3463abb43ac82d4dff5adc OP_EQUAL
- address
- 3491oPWQw9ZPpjcYBjcPDyZHRbtFdnTbjd